BLOOMFIELD, NJ – The Bears women's basketball team were defeated at home against Caldwell University Saturday afternoon in a, 65-56 Central Atlantic Collegiate Conference (CACC) battle in The Den.
RECORDS
- Bloomfield 3-6 (0-2 CACC), Caldwell 4-4(1-1 CACC)

HOW IT HAPPENED
- Bloomfield jumped in front early, reeling off the first seven points of the game capped by a layup from Babbs. Moments later a Babbs three-pointer gave the home squad their largest lead of the game (8) at 10-2 with 6:39 on the clock.
- The Cougars clawed their way back with a, 12-2 spurt that finished out the quarter. The 2nd period was a see-saw battle with the teams trading buckets but the Bears sneaked out a, 30-29 advantage at halftime.
- The 3rd quarter saw the guests flex with the first 14 points that put Bloomfield on their heels, down 43-30. The home team took their time and chipped away at the deficit to close within three (45-42) with 2:17 to play in the frame.
- The fourth quarter belonged to Caldwell and their advantage ballooned to 14 points before they secured the conference win.
INSIDE THE NUMBERS
- The Cougars out-rebounded the Bears, 44-40 but Bloomfield had better bench production at, 19-6
- Caldwell held an advantage in points in the paint (28-16) and points off of turnovers (24-10)
